Ontario Bencher Elections Approaching

Bencher elections are fast approaching, and voter turnout appears to remain low, reportedly at 12,567 votes out of a potential 40,000 as of April 28,2011. The Law Society has published a voting guide with bios of all of the candidates. Voting closes at 5:00 p.m. EDT on April 29. The election will be conducted online through a secure website. Forty benchers will be elected – 20 from inside Toronto and 20 from outside Toronto. You can find more information about the voting process on the Law Society of Upper Canada website.
